Makuru FC is a Solomon Islands football club, playing in the Honiara FA League.

They won the 2004 and 2006/2007 Honiara FA League title.[1] The team is also known as JP Su'uria.
They declined to join the newly formed Telekom S-League due to religious reasons since they did not want to play on Saturdays.[2]
